How much do credit card operations manager jobs pay per year?

As of May 28, 2026, the average yearly pay for credit card operations manager in Maryland is $65,665.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$34,900.00 and $89,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a Credit Card Operations Manager do?

A Credit Card Operations Manager oversees the daily activities and processes involved in managing credit card operations for a financial institution. Their responsibilities include ensuring compliance with regulations, managing transaction processing, monitoring fraud prevention systems, and improving operational efficiency. They also supervise staff, coordinate with other departments, and implement policies to provide seamless customer service. This role requires strong leadership, analytical skills, and a thorough understanding of credit card products and industry regulations.

What is the difference between Credit Card Operations Manager vs Credit Analyst?

AspectCredit Card Operations ManagerCredit Analyst
Primary FocusOversees credit card processing, transaction management, and operational efficiencyAssesses creditworthiness of individuals or businesses to determine loan or credit risk
Required SkillsOperational management, compliance, process optimizationFinancial analysis, risk assessment, credit scoring
Work EnvironmentBanking or financial institution operations teamsCredit departments, lending teams, financial analysis units
CertificationsTypically requires banking or financial certifications; sometimes project managementOften requires CFA, CPA, or related financial certifications

The Credit Card Operations Manager focuses on managing the day-to-day operations of credit card processing and ensuring compliance, while the Credit Analyst evaluates credit risk to support lending decisions. Both roles require financial knowledge but serve different functions within financial institutions.

Here's a Snapshot of the Position:

Finance, Billing, & Payments:

You'll be the backbone of our financial workflow, ensuring accuracy and compliance at every step.
Your work will include:

  • Managing SBGP's general inbox dedicated to finance, billing, and payments.
  • Coordinating, tracking, and managing payment requests from grantees and vendors-monitoring compliance, approvals, and timely processing.
  • Reviewing all payment submissions for accuracy, completeness, proper documentation, budget alignment, and adherence to accounting standards and external requirements (including City MBE/WBE participation).
  • Troubleshooting delayed or interrupted payments and working with staff, grantees, and vendors to resolve issues quickly.
  • Maintaining vendor records, including W9s, payment documentation, and related files.
  • Reconciling organizational credit card activity, gathering receipts, and coordinating payment processing.
  • Supporting the annual financial audit with documentation, organization, and preparation.

Compliance & Administration:

You will help ensure SBGP remains compliant, organized, and aligned with best practices by:

  • Reviewing and updating organizational policies and procedures.
  • Maintaining compliance with the Open Meetings Act and the Public Information Act.
  • Assisting in ongoing policy development, updates, and implementation.
  • Providing administrative and logistical support to staff across the organization as needed.

About South Baltimore Gateway Partnership:
When slot machine gambling came to Maryland, South Baltimore residents were promised the resources to improve their communities. South Baltimore Gateway Partnership (SBGP) is fulfilling that promise. Guided by our Strategic Plan, SBGP focuses on three crucial elements of the South Baltimore Gateway Master Plan: Environmental Sustainability, Health and Wellness, and Community Development and Revitalization.
